Afternoon guys, it's been a long while since I've written anything about my 09/6MT (all stock unfortunately) but I have a bit of an issue that neither the dealer nor Acura corporate have a fix for:

Moonroof is open in the tilt position, I'm hearing a clicking when trying to open or close (auto, no glass movement) and slight movement and clicking when trying to partially open/close.

I don't use it that often, and first issue was yesterday after work, it closed eventually (~45 minute commute each way). Anybody have this issue? I can't see anything blocking the rails. My first thought is bad motor, and lord that fix looks like a sunnuva bitch.
